Cedar shingle repair services typically involve assessing and restoring damaged or deteriorating cedar shingles on a property's roof or exterior walls. This process includes replacing broken or missing shingles, fixing areas affected by rot or insect damage, and addressing issues caused by weather exposure. Skilled contractors carefully remove the compromised shingles and install new ones that match the existing style and color, helping to preserve the home's aesthetic while ensuring its protective barrier remains effective.

This service is essential for solving common problems such as cracked or warped shingles, moss or mold growth, and areas where shingles have become loose or fallen off. Over time, cedar shingles can suffer from exposure to moisture, pests, or harsh weather, leading to leaks or structural vulnerabilities. Repairing these issues promptly can prevent more extensive damage, like wood rot or water infiltration, which may result in costly repairs down the line.

Many types of properties benefit from cedar shingle repair, including historic homes, residential houses, and cottages that feature cedar siding or roofing. These shingles are often chosen for their natural appearance and durability, but they require regular maintenance to stay in good condition. Whether a property is a single-family home or a multi-unit building, local contractors can evaluate the shingles’ condition and recommend repairs to extend their lifespan and maintain the property's curb appeal.

Homeowners who notice signs of damage or aging on their cedar shingles should consider repair services to address issues early. Common indicators include missing shingles, visible cracks, mold or moss growth, or areas where shingles have become loose. Addressing these problems with professional repair helps ensure the exterior of the property remains weather-resistant, visually appealing, and structurally sound for years to come.

The overview below groups typical Cedar Shingles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Fayetteville, NC.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- Most minor cedar shingle repairs, such as replacing a few damaged shingles, typically cost between $250 and $600. Many routine fixes fall within this range, depending on the extent of the damage and accessibility.

Partial Roof Repairs - When addressing larger sections of damage or multiple shingles, local contractors often charge between $600 and $1,500. These projects are common and usually involve replacing several shingles or fixing localized issues.

Full Roof Replacement - Replacing an entire cedar shingle roof can range from $7,000 to $15,000 or more, depending on the size of the roof and material quality. Larger, more complex projects can reach higher costs but are less frequent than smaller repairs.

Complex or Custom Jobs - Unique or extensive repairs, including structural work or custom finishes, can exceed $20,000. Such projects are less common and typically involve additional factors that influence pricing beyond standard repair estimates.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

How do I know if cedar shingles need repair? Signs such as cracked, curled, or missing shingles, as well as water stains or leaks inside the home, can indicate the need for cedar shingle repair services by local contractors in Fayetteville, NC.

What types of damage can local pros fix on cedar shingles? They can address issues like splitting, warping, mold growth, and damage from pests to restore the shingles’ integrity and appearance.

Are there different repair options available for cedar shingles? Yes, service providers can perform simple patch repairs, shingle replacement, or more extensive restoration depending on the extent of the damage.

How can I prepare my property for cedar shingle repair? Clearing the area around the roof and ensuring access can help local contractors efficiently perform repairs on cedar shingles.
